Dr. Sumit Kumar Banshal

Assistant Professor & Central Blended Learning Coordinator

Alliance College of Engineering and Design

Dr. Sumit Kumar Banshal completed his Ph.D. in Computer Science and M.Sc. in Computer Science from South Asian University (A SAARC organization). His Ph.D. thesis concentrated around the broader area of Information Sciences where he theorized the scholarly article engagements on social media platforms. He has established some crucial linking in between impact assessment of scholarly articles and social media transactions around the same. He completed his B.Sc. (Hons.) in Information and Communication Engineering from Department of Information and Communication Engineering, University of Rajshahi, Bangladesh.

Before his post-graduation, Dr. Banshal has worked for a software development company at Dhaka, where he developed several application-based customized software in .NET platform. His research works spread around text processing, data mining, sentiment analysis, social media analysis. He has taught versatile courses like Data Mining, Web Engineering, Research & Innovation, Social & Professional Issues in Computing, Object Oriented Programming during his academic career.
